MERRYL GREAVES
Merryl began painting in 1997 at John Ogburn studio in Glebe. She learnt much about painting and philosophy over the nine years from John Ogburn's teaching. There, with a community oriented group of students she exhibited in small group and studio exhibitions at the Harrington Street Gallery in Chippendale.
She, in recent years, has been painting abstract paintings under the guidance of Tony Tozer. Merryl has exhibited in the Ewart Art prize and Mosman2088 as well as the Mosman Art Prize. |
She shares a studio with 3 other painters at George's heights which she finds exhilarating and conducive to her painting, drawing from the energy of this beautiful place and fellow painters.
